Ghost Hunter [Combat]

3e Summary::You smack around those folks in the spirit world.

Benefits: This is a combat feat that scales with your Base Attack Bonus.

  • +0: Your attacks have a 50% chance of striking incorporeal opponents even if they are not magical.
  • +1: You can hear incorporeal and ethereal creatures as if they lacked those traits (note that shadows and the like rarely bother to actively move silently).
  • +6: You can see invisible and ethereal creatures as if they lacked those traits.
  • +11: Your attacks count as if you had the Ghost Touch property on your weapons.
  • +16: Any Armor or shield you use benefits from the Ghost Touch quality.
